1. Jannis Leidel
  2. django-lfs

Source

django-lfs / lfs / templates / manage / reviews / reviews_inline.html

{% load i18n %}
{% load lfs_tags %}

<form action="{% url lfs_set_review_filters %}"
      method="POST">

	<table class="filters">
		<tr>
			<td class="discreet">{% trans "Pages" %}</td>
			<td class="discreet">{% trans "Name" %}</td>
			<td class="discreet">{% trans "Active" %}</td>
		</tr>
		<tr>
			<td>
				<div class="navigation-pages">
				    {% if page.has_previous %}
				        <a class="ajax-link"
				           href="{% url lfs_reviews_inline %}?page=1">
				            <img src="{{ STATIC_URL }}lfs/icons/resultset_first.png"
				                 alt="{% trans 'First' %}"
				                 title="{% trans 'First' %}" />
						</a>
				        <a class="ajax-link"
				           href="{% url lfs_reviews_inline %}?page={{ page.previous_page_number }}">
				            <img src="{{ STATIC_URL }}lfs/icons/resultset_previous.png"
				                 alt="{% trans 'Previous' %}"
				                 title="{% trans 'Previous' %}" />
						</a>
				    {% else %}
				        <img src="{{ STATIC_URL }}lfs/icons/resultset_first.png"
				             alt="{% trans 'First' %}"
				             title="{% trans 'First' %}" />
				        <img src="{{ STATIC_URL }}lfs/icons/resultset_previous.png"
				             alt="{% trans 'Previous' %}"
				             title="{% trans 'Previous' %}" />
				    {% endif %}

				    {{ page.number }} {% trans "of" %} {{ paginator.num_pages }}

				    {% if page.has_next %}
				        <a class="ajax-link"
				           href="{% url lfs_reviews_inline %}?page={{ page.next_page_number }}">
				            <img src="{{ STATIC_URL }}lfs/icons/resultset_next.png"
				                 alt="{% trans 'Next' %}"
				                 title="{% trans 'Next' %}" />
						</a>
				        <a class="ajax-link"
				           href="{% url lfs_reviews_inline %}?page={{ paginator.num_pages }}">
				            <img src="{{ STATIC_URL }}lfs/icons/resultset_last.png"
				                 alt="{% trans 'Last' %}"
				                 title="{% trans 'Last' %}" />
						</a>

				    {% else %}
				        <span>
				            <img src="{{ STATIC_URL }}lfs/icons/resultset_next.png"
				                 alt="{% trans 'Next' %}"
				                 title="{% trans 'Next' %}" />
				        </span>
				        <span>
				            <img src="{{ STATIC_URL }}lfs/icons/resultset_last.png"
				                 alt="{% trans 'Last' %}"
				                 title="{% trans 'Last' %}" />
				        </span>
				    {% endif %}
				</div>
			</td>
			<td>
				<input type="text"
				       name="name"
					   value="{{ name }}">
			</td>
			<td>
				<select name="active">
					<option value="">---</option>
					<option {% ifequal active "1" %}selected="selected"{% endifequal %}value="1">{% trans "Yes" %}</option>
					<option {% ifequal active "0" %}selected="selected"{% endifequal %}value="0">{% trans "No" %}</option>
				</select>
			</td>
			<td>
				<input type="submit"
				       class="ajax-save-button-2" />
	
				<a href="{% url lfs_reset_review_filters %}"
				   class="ajax-link reset">&nbsp;</a>
			</td>
		</tr>
	</table>
</form>
<table class="lfs-manage-table">
    <tr>
        <th class="tiny">
			<a class="ajax-link"
			   href='{% url lfs_set_review_ordering "id" %}'>
            	{% trans 'ID' %}
           	</a>
        </th>
        <th class="middle">
			<a class="ajax-link"
			   href='{% url lfs_set_review_ordering "creation_date" %}'>
            	{% trans 'Creation date' %}
			</a>	
        </th>
        <th class="long">
			<a class="ajax-link"
			   href='{% url lfs_set_review_ordering "user_name" %}'>
            	{% trans 'Name' %}
			</a>
        </th>
        <th>
			<a class="ajax-link" 
			   href='{% url lfs_set_review_ordering "user_email" %}'>
            	{% trans 'E-Mail' %}
			</a>
        </th>
        <th>
			<a class="ajax-link" 
			   href='{% url lfs_set_review_ordering "product" %}'>
            	{% trans 'Product' %}
			</a>
        </th>
        <th class="small">
			<a class="ajax-link"
			   href='{% url lfs_set_review_ordering "score" %}'>
            	{% trans 'Score' %}
			</a>	
        </th>
        <th class="small">
            {% trans 'Comment' %}
        </th>
        <th class="tiny">
            {% trans 'Active' %}
        </th>
    </tr>

    {% for review in page.object_list %}
        <tr class="clickable"
            onclick="window.location='{% url lfs_manage_review review.id %}'">
            <td>
               	{{ review.id }}
            </td>
        	<td>
                {{ review.creation_date|date:"d.m.Y" }}
            </td>
            <td>
				{% if review.user_name %}
					{{ review.user_name }}
				{% else %}
					---
				{% endif %}                
            </td>
            <td>
				{% if review.user_email %}
					{{ review.user_email }}
				{% else %}
					---
				{% endif %}
            </td>
            <td>
				<a href="{{ review.content.get_absolute_url }}">
					{{ review.content.get_name }}
				</a>	                
            </td>
            <td>
				{{ review.score }}
            </td>
            <td>
				{% if review.comment %}
					<img src="../icons/tick.png"
					     alt="{% trans 'Yes' %}">
				{% else %}				
					<img src="../icons/delete.png"
					     alt="{% trans 'No' %}">
				{% endif %}				
            </td>
            <td>
				{% if review.active %}
					<img src="../icons/tick.png"
					     alt="{% trans 'Yes' %}">
				{% else %}				
					<img src="../icons/delete.png"
					     alt="{% trans 'No' %}">
				{% endif %}				
            </td>
        </tr>
    {% endfor %}
</table>